Clinical Service Lead-Community Nursing Location: Main bases in Chesterfield and Derby, travel across different peripheral bases across Derbyshire Hours: 37.5 hours per week Pay: £47440 per annum At DHU Healthcare, every role matters. We're a not-for-profit team driven by compassion and respect, where your voice is heard and your growth truly matters. Join us and be part of something bigger. For you, for them, with us. With us, every moment matters. Our UEC teams deliver expert care 24/7, working together to respond quickly when it's needed most. Why does your role matter? The Clinical Service Lead (Community Nursing Care) will support the wider leadership team within urgent care working alongside the Clinical Director, Deputy Clinical Director & Head of Palliative and Community Nursing in the delivery of Community Nursing Care services across Derbyshire. The post holder will provide professional clinical and operational leadership to an integrated team ensuring that processes are in place to support the achievement of organisational goals, a culture of patient safety and high standards of care delivery. The post holder will work blended hours during the week. This will include 30 in-hours and 7.5 clinical out-of-hours per week within the service. This will ensure a visible presence to support both clinical and operational teams. Role and Responsibilities: Provide visible, compassionate, and effective clinical leadership across the Palliative Care service, fostering a culture where roles, responsibilities, and professional accountability are clearly understood and staff are empowered to deliver high - quality care. Support the Senior Leadership Team to ensure services operate efficiently, meet contractual and commissioning requirements, and align with organisational priorities. Lead the ongoing review, development, and implementation of palliative care clinical pathways, ensuring compliance with quality standards, national guidance, and agreed key performance indicators. Provide expert clinical oversight and contribute to the development, implementation, and monitoring of clinical standards and best practice, using evidence - based decision - making and sound clinical judgement. Contribute to service development initiatives, ensuring agreed changes are implemented effectively and evaluated for impact and patient outcomes. Support delivery of CQUINs and other quality initiatives relevant to palliative and end - of - life care.
